SecureQuery
SecureQuery — Обрабатывает данные указанными методами
Описание
mixed SecureQuery( mixed $data [, string $methods = "tags,sql" [, string $fields = "all" ] ] )
Методы в переменной methods
перечисляются через запятую. Доступные методы для обработки:
- tags -
strip_tags()
- int -
intval()
- sql - если не задан
magic_quotes_gpc
, то обрабатываетmysql_real_escape_string()
, в противном случае пропускает - sqlnomagic -
mysql_real_escape_string()
- slashes -
addslashes()
- htmlchars -
htmlspecialchars()
Список параметров
data
- Строка или массив с данными для экранирования. Массив может быть многомерным (рекурсивный обход)
methods
- Методы которыми обрабатываем
fields
- Указание ключей массива, элементы которых надо обрабатывать если массив. Если "all" то обрабатываются все элементы.
Смотрите также:
- SecureQuery_str — Обрабатывает строку указанными методами